A hypothesis is a reasonable guess based on something that you observe in the natural world.
A theory is a combination of multiple hypothesis which are tested nd retested again and again.
Ana's statement is a hypothesis because it is a statement of common sense but it has not been tested by Ana yet and there could be multiple different results and thus it is not a theory.
For example, More batteries do provide more energy but if all the batteries are providing energy at the same time the life of bulb will not be effected.
It is observed that Batteries connected in series to a bulb increases voltage and hence, brighter bulb while connecting batteries in parallel with the bulb will increase the overall battery capacity.
